Capture the Flag is a game that combines strategy, stealth, and teamwork, making it an absolute favorite among summer campers. Divided into two teams, campers strategize to capture the opponent’s flag while simultaneously protecting their own. The game requires careful planning and coordination, as players must decide when to attack, when to defend, and how to outwit their opponents. This fosters strategic thinking and problem-solving skills, as campers learn to analyze the situation, anticipate the moves of their opponents, and devise effective strategies to achieve victory.

Stealth plays a crucial role in Capture the Flag, as campers must move silently and covertly to avoid detection by the opposing team. This not only adds an element of excitement to the game but also encourages campers to develop their stealth and agility. By honing these skills, campers learn the importance of patience, precision, and the art of surprise. Additionally, the game emphasizes the significance of teamwork and communication. Campers must work together, coordinating their efforts to successfully capture the flag and defend their own. This promotes effective communication, collaboration, and the ability to trust and rely on one another.

When the summer sun is shining brightly, there’s no better way to cool off and have a splash than with a fun-filled Water Balloon Toss game. Campers pair up and stand at a distance from each other, armed with water-filled balloons. The objective is simple: toss the balloons back and forth without bursting them. The game may start off easy, with gentle tosses, but as the excitement builds, the throws become more challenging, requiring precise hand-eye coordination and teamwork.

Water Balloon Toss not only provides a refreshing break from other intense activities but also enhances campers’ hand-eye coordination. As they aim to catch and throw the water-filled balloons, campers develop their motor skills, improving their ability to judge distance and timing. The game requires campers to focus their attention, track the trajectory of the balloon, and make split-second decisions on how to catch or throw it. These skills are not only valuable in the game but also in various sports and activities that require agility and precision.

Scavenger Hunt is a game that never fails to ignite the sense of adventure in campers. It challenges them to work together, solve riddles, and embark on a quest to find hidden treasures. The game begins with a set of clues or a treasure map that leads campers to various locations within the campsite. As they decipher the clues and navigate through obstacles, the excitement builds, and the bond among participants strengthens.

Scavenger Hunt is not just a game; it is an adventure that encourages critical thinking and problem-solving. Campers must analyze the clues, think creatively, and collaborate with their teammates to unravel the mystery and progress to the next stage. This fosters their ability to think outside the box, approach challenges from different perspectives, and develop innovative solutions. As campers face obstacles along the way, they learn to adapt, persevere, and overcome difficulties, gaining a sense of accomplishment and boosting their self-confidence.

Tug of War is a game that has stood the test of time, captivating campers with its blend of strength, strategy, and determination. Divided into two teams, campers line up on either side of a rope, gripping it tightly. The objective is simple yet challenging: pull the rope with all their might, attempting to bring the opposing team over a designated line. This game not only tests physical strength but also fosters important life skills such as teamwork, communication, and perseverance.

In Tug of War, strength alone is not enough to secure victory. Strategic thinking and effective communication play a crucial role in this game. Campers must develop a plan, determining the placement of their teammates based on their strength and abilities. They must synchronize their movements, pulling in unison to create a stronger force. This teaches campers the importance of strategy, coordination, and the ability to adapt their approach when faced with challenges.

For campers seeking an adrenaline-pumping adventure, the Obstacle Course is the perfect game. Designed to test their physical and mental limits, the course is filled with a variety of challenging obstacles that campers must conquer. From climbing walls and crawling through tunnels to balancing on beams and swinging across ropes, the Obstacle Course offers campers a thrilling adventure that pushes them to unleash their potential.

As campers face each obstacle, they are presented with a unique challenge that requires problem-solving skills and physical prowess. They must assess the obstacle, determine the best approach, and summon the courage to take action. This fosters resilience, as campers learn to overcome setbacks and persevere through difficulties. The Obstacle Course also provides an opportunity for campers to confront their fears head-on, whether it be fear of heights, tight spaces, or physical exertion. By conquering these fears, campers develop a newfound sense of self-confidence and a belief in their own abilities.

Sack Race is a game that never fails to bring laughter and joy to summer camp. Campers eagerly step into large sacks and hop their way to the finish line, with their legs confined in the sack. The hilarity ensues as campers navigate the racecourse, trying to maintain their balance and coordination while bouncing around in the sacks.

While Sack Race is undeniably entertaining, it also offers valuable benefits to campers. The game promotes balance and coordination as campers must find their footing and adapt to the unique challenge of hopping in a sack. They learn to control their movements, make quick adjustments, and maintain their balance, all while being enveloped in the fabric of the sack. This not only enhances their physical abilities but also improves their overall body awareness.

As the sun sets and the stars twinkle above, campers gather around a crackling campfire for a night of captivating stories. Campfire Storytelling is a game that allows campers to unleash their creativity and imagination, transporting themselves and their fellow campers to worlds filled with adventure, mystery, and laughter.

Gathered in a circle, campers take turns sharing their stories, whether they be thrilling tales of daring escapades or funny anecdotes that leave everyone in stitches. Campfire Storytelling not only provides entertainment but also offers valuable benefits to campers. It fosters public speaking skills as campers learn to articulate their thoughts, project their voices, and engage their audience. This boosts their confidence, as they receive positive feedback and support from their fellow campers. The game also creates a sense of community, as campers listen attentively to each other’s stories, laugh together, and bond over shared experiences.
